Located
approximately 814 kilometers from Bangkok
is Krabi Province, one of most attractive
destinations in southern Thailand. Encompassing
an area of 4,708 square kilometers, the
western border of Krabi is the Andaman Sea,
the northern borders are Surat Thani and
Phang-nga Provinces, the southern borders
are Trang Province and the Andaman Sea and
the eastern borders are Nakhon Si Thammarat
and Trang Provinces. Krabi is an ideal getaway
destination teeming with natural attractions
including white sandy beaches, fascinating
coral reefs, num erous
large and small islands and verdant forests
with caves and waterfalls.
Krabi's
topography is mostly mountains and highlands
separated by plains in some parts. Flowing
through Krabi City to the Andaman Sea at
Pak Nam Sub-district is Maenam Krabi which
is 5 kilometers in length. In addition,
there are several canals originating from
the province's highest mountain range, Khao
Phanom Bencha including Khlong Pakasai,
Khlong Krabi Yai and Khlong Krabi Noi. Lush
mangrove forests line the canals and the
banks of Maenam Krabi particularly before
it empties into the Andaman Sea. The provinces
sandy soil conditions are suitable for growing
various agricultural products, particularly
rubber trees, palms, coconuts, cashew nuts
and coffee.
Due
to the influence of the tropical monsoon,
there are only two seasons in Krabi; the
hot season from January to April and the
rainy season from May to D ecember.
Temperatures range between 17 °C and
37 °C.
Krabi
is administratively divided into 8 Amphoes
(Districts): Amphoe Mueang, Khao Phanom,
Khlong Thom, Plai Phraya, Ko Lanta, Ao Luek,
Lam Thap, and Nuea Khlong. The provinces
jurisdiction covers not only in-land districts
and sub-districts, but also extends to more
than 130 large and small islands including
the world famous Phi Phi Islands.
In
addition, Krabi is the location of two world
class beaches Ao Nang and Hat Rai Le which
offer numerous diving trips, restaurants,
shops etc. Additional attractions in the
province are stunning limestone cliffs and
rock formations which make it a heaven for
rock climbers and a National Park located
approximately 40 kilometers outside of town
with lakes, caves and spectacular natural
scenery.
